Listen "Being flexitarian with Chef Fab"
Episode Synopsis
In this episode, we meet Chef Fab, a boutique owner-turned-restaurateur. Fab’s creations aim to feed "flexitarians" the comfort foods they miss while eating more plant-based diets.
From the Crain’s newsroom, Ally Marotti reports on the surprise early closure of Gold Coast steakhouse Tavern on Rush.
